Preview: Torino vs Lazio

Hosts Torino find themselves in a rather precarious position after losing 4-2 to Cagliari last weekend. The Granata sit in 14th place, with just one win from their last five Serie A games and while they are not exactly in danger of relegation just yet, their poor form could see them slide further down the table unless if they find a way to turn things around quickly. Although they do manage to find the back of the net, they really struggle defensively, as was shown against Cagliari, where they tried to claw their way back into the game after going 3-0 down but couldn't find a way to keep their opponents at bay in order to hang on for at least a point.

Meanwhile, Lazio managed to get past Fiorentina in order to move to within four points of Juventus, but Viola fans will certainly feel aggrieved by the result. The Tuscan side had a 1-0 lead thanks to a goal from Franck Ribery, but saw things turn against them as the Aquile were given a penalty that Ciro Immobile converted for the equalizer before Luis Alberto grabbed the game winner late a few minutes before regulation time concluded.

A win here would help the capital-based club and Scudetto aspirants re-close their gap on Juventus to just a point before the Bianconeri face another struggling side, Genoa, in the later game. However, Lazio will have to make do without coach Simone Inzaghi as he was sent off during their clash with Fiorentina for his outburst during stoppage time.

Team news: Torino vs Lazio

Torino: Daniele Baselli and Simone Zaza are out injured for the hosts.

Lazio: Luiz Felipe, Danilo Cataldi, Lucas Leiva, Bobby Adekanye, and Senad Lulic all remain out for the visitors.

Match facts: Torino vs Lazio

  • Torino's home record vs Lazio: W28 D23 L13
  • Lazio have won 17 of their last 20 matches in Serie A
